Hi,

the update via webGUI failed - so I started it via /opt/psa/bin/autoinstaller
Plesk is now updated to 9.2.3 - but /opt/psa/bin/ doesn't contain 'pleskbackup' and 'autoinstaller' anymore.
In the dir /usr/local/psa can only the dir 'var' be found.

I fixed it myself:

I found the autoinstaller in /opt/psa/admin/bin and started it from there.
Now Plesk is completely back in service.
